Bläddra i källkod

OBJLoader: Better fix for #5008.

Mr.doob 11 år sedan
förälder
incheckning
4fb34b4dae
1 ändrade filer med 4 tillägg och 2 borttagningar
  1. 4 2
      examples/js/loaders/OBJLoader.js

+ 4 - 2
examples/js/loaders/OBJLoader.js

@@ -190,9 +190,11 @@ THREE.OBJLoader.prototype = {
 
 		var face_pattern4 = /f( +(-?\d+)\/\/(-?\d+))( +(-?\d+)\/\/(-?\d+))( +(-?\d+)\/\/(-?\d+))( +(-?\d+)\/\/(-?\d+))?/
 
-		//
+		// fixes
 
-		var lines = text.replace(/\\\n/g,' ').split( '\n' );
+		text = text.replace( /\\\r\n/g, '' ); // handles line continuations \
+
+		var lines = text.split( '\n' );
 
 		for ( var i = 0; i < lines.length; i ++ ) {